UCG syngas production does produce a reasonable amount of CO2 along with the usefull bits H2 and CO. It is the particulates that are left underground. In the case of CNX there seems to also be a high percentage of CH4 and C2H6 which will also produce CO2 when combusted.
So, unfortunately, CO2 as a result of syngas production and usage will still have to be sequestered.
